I have used these  125A and they seem ok, they have quite strong blowout magnets inside for arc quenching, unlike other cheap brands.

Better and what I'm using now are these , a lot more robust and available in quite high currents.

Those cheaper rail mounted breakers have to be kept cool, by using 50mm^2 cable to act as a heatsink, don't place them in a small box or jammed in with others as they will get hot and trip prematurely.
